π§π₯ͺ Cooking Day: Homemade Grilled Cheese! π©βπ³π¨βπ³
Today, our little chefs made their very own grilled cheese sandwiches from start to finish! First, they spread butter on each slice of bread, practicing their fine motor skills and independence. Next, they placed the bread in the oven until it became perfectly golden and crispy before carefully adding a slice of cheese. Finally, they cut their grilled cheese sandwiches and enjoyed the delicious treat they worked so hard to make! ππ
Cooking activities help children build confidence, strengthen fine motor skills, follow directions, and learn valuable life skillsβall while having fun! We are so proud of our amazing little chefs! β€οΈβ¨
